Transaction 81e70fe1406f8b517d9f57cedd00f5652aa74aa018757a99c9461513a1cb0235

1 Input
2 Outputs
  • 81e70fe1406f8b517d9f57cedd00f5652aa74aa018757a99c9461513a1cb0235:0
  • value  8546548
    address  3CMmYrRMcLwH4NbMypLnAV3Xgk4SLxETPz
  • 81e70fe1406f8b517d9f57cedd00f5652aa74aa018757a99c9461513a1cb0235:1
  • value  31316896
    address  1DyaGwZg7fFMkXhMWoA5q3yTyUm5GqUvvJ